How large an expansion gap should be left between steel railroad rails if they may reach a maximum temperature 40.0°C greater th

an when they were laid? Their original length is 41.0 m.

Answer:

19.68 × 10⁻³ m

Explanation:

Given;

Original Length, L₁ = 41.0 m

Temperature Change, ΔT = 40.0°C

Thermal Linear expansion of steel is given to be, ∝_{steel} = 12 × 10⁻⁶ /°C

   Generally, Linear expansivity is expressed as;

                               ∝ = ΔL / L₁ΔT

Where

∝ is the Linear expansivity

ΔL is the change in length, L₂ - L₁

L₂ is the final length

L₁ is the original length

ΔT is the change in temperature θ₂ - θ₁ (Final Temperature - Initial Temperature)              

From equation of linear expansivity

                         ΔL = ∝_{steel}L₁ΔT

                         ΔL = 12 × 10⁻⁶ /°C × 41.0 m × 40.0 °C

                         ΔL = 19.68 × 10⁻³ m

                         ΔL = 19.68 mm
